The role of an administrative agency is that of _______. The role of an administrative agency is that of _______. passing legisl
kherson [118]

Answer:    Enforcement and elaboration of laws passed by Congress

Explanation:  Administrative agencies have a task, that is, they are in charge of elaborating, developing and enforcing the law. Administrative agencies are established by Congress, which also oversees their work, while agencies, on the other hand, deal with laws passed by Congress. The responsibility of the President in this case is to appoint heads of agencies. In addition to these competencies, the administrative agencies have the task of making rules, so that all these important functions are collectively referred to as the administrative procedure.
